Big Buddha and the panoramic views

The highlight for many of our sources is the Big Buddha Phuket, perched atop Mount Nagakerd. The admission is included, and you’ll spend about 45 minutes here. The real draw is the 360-degree view of Phuket’s southern coast, with sweeping vistas of the beaches and the surrounding sea. Guides often share fascinating tidbits about the Buddha’s significance and the construction process, which adds depth to the experience. As one reviewer noted, “The view from the Big Buddha is breathtaking, and it’s a great spot for photos.”

Chalong Temple: a spiritual and architectural marvel

Next up is Chalong Temple, the most famous temple on the island. Expect to spend around 45 minutes exploring its ornate architecture and sacred relics. Guides typically highlight the importance of this revered religious site and its architecture, which combines traditional Thai styles with some Chinese influences. The temple’s peaceful ambiance offers a moment of calm and reflection amid the busy sightseeing.

Cashew nut factory visit and taste test

A visit to the Cashew Nut Factory offers a chance to sample local produce and learn how these beloved nuts are processed. The taste testing is a highlight for many, giving insight into local trade and agriculture. It’s a relaxed stop and a welcome break to stroll and shop for souvenirs. The included tasting adds a flavorful touch to the tour.

Phuket Old Town: a walk through history

Walking through Phuket Town’s Old Quarter allows you to appreciate the Sino-Portuguese architecture, with colorful buildings and streets that echo the island’s multicultural past. About 45 minutes are allocated here, during which guides often point out interesting details about the buildings and history. The atmosphere is vibrant and photogenic, making this an excellent opportunity for street photography.

Weekend market (only for Saturday & Sunday tours)

If you’re taking the tour on a weekend, the last stop is a night market. Here, you can browse stalls selling local food, crafts, and souvenirs, adding a lively, authentic atmosphere to your day. If you’re visiting midweek, this segment is skipped, but the rest of the itinerary remains unchanged.

Is pickup included in the tour?
Yes, the tour offers roundtrip pickup from Patong, Kata, and Karon, making it very convenient for guests staying in those areas.

How long does each stop last?
Each major stop is designed to be around 45 minutes, with some variation depending on the location and group pace. The total tour lasts about 5 to 6 hours.

What’s included in the price?
The price covers admission tickets to Big Buddha and Chalong Temple, guided commentary, bottled water, coffee/tea, roundtrip transfers, and accident insurance.

Can I cancel this tour?
Yes, it’s free to c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und. Cancellations less than 24 hours before the tour are non-refundable.

Is this tour suitable for all ages?
Most travelers can participate, and the group size is small, which makes it manageable. However, young children should be able to handle a half-day sightseeing schedule comfortably.

What should I bring?
Bring water, sun protection, and comfortable shoes. Since some stops are outdoor, weather-appropriate clothing is advisable, especially if it’s hot or rainy.
